How do I keep figures and captions together in Word?
Option 1: Use a Text Box
- Make sure the figure is in-line (not floating).
- Make sure the title or caption is not in a text box. That is, it has to be ordinary text.
- Select both the figure and the title or caption.
- Insert the Text Box.
- Note: The Text Box will stay on the same page as the paragraph to which it is anchored.
How do I reduce space between figure and caption?
Remove space after figure and before text
- \floatsep – Space between floats. \dblfloatsep for 2 column format.
- \intextsep – Space above and below in-line text floats.
- \abovecaptionskip – Space above float caption.
- \belowcaptionskip – Space below float caption.

How do I stop my figures from moving in Word?
Click on the Advanced button. Click on the Picture Position tab. Under both the Horizontal and Vertical selections, select Absolute Position, and pick “Page” from the drop-down menu at the right. Also, click on the checkbox that says “Lock anchor.” Now, your pictures won’t move around the page.

How do I get rid of white spaces in overleaf?
You can add negative as well as positive space with an \vspace command. LaTeX removes vertical space that comes at the end of a page. If you don’t want LaTeX to remove this space, include the optional * argument. Then the space is never removed.
How do you organize figures in Word?
Click in your document where you want to insert the table of figures. Click References > Insert Table of Figures. You can adjust your Format and Options in the Table of Figures dialog box. Click OK.
